Waterspout watch in effect

Dixon Entrance East

Issued 3:39 PM PDT 16 August 2025 Conditions are favourable for the development of waterspouts.


Wind speeds inside the spray ring of a waterspout are 45 knots or higher. Vulnerable vessels are at risk of damage or capsizing. Keep in mind that waterspouts cannot be seen at night and may strike suddenly. Waterspouts are generally isolated in nature although they can also occur in families of two or more. Waterspouts are generally short-lived in nature, typically lasting 20 minutes or less.
